The former mansion of businessman and former Italian Prime Minister Silvio Berlusconi is on sale for 500 million euros. Villa Certosa is located in Sardinia, an Italian island in the Mediterranean Sea, reports Financial Times.
The list of luxuries owned by the Italian, who died in June 2023, is extensive: a 120-hectare park, a complex of 126 houses, a seaside amphitheater for 300 people, a nuclear shelter, an artificial lake, tennis courts and an erupting artificial volcano.
Berlusconi bought the house in the 1980s and it was renovated and expanded in subsequent years.
The mansion hosted several “bunga-bunga” parties, an event that brought together prostitutes and politicians in orgies. Government leaders such as the American George Bush or the Russian Vladimir Putin have stayed at this luxurious hotel.
